Is Androxgh0st Botnet’s Integration with Mozi a New IoT Threat?

Since its emergence in January 2024, the Androxgh0st botnet has demonstrated a remarkable capacity to infiltrate web servers by exploiting vulnerabilities in widely used technologies, marking it as a significant cybersecurity threat. By leveraging weaknesses in high-profile systems such as Cisco ASA, Atlassian JIRA, and various PHP frameworks, Androxgh0st has managed to evade many traditional security measures. Recently, it has taken a concerning turn by integrating with the payloads of the defunct Mozi botnet, expanding its reach into Internet of Things (IoT) environments. This development has raised the stakes for enterprise and IoT security, prompting urgent advisories from cybersecurity experts.

Key Vulnerabilities and Exploitation

Androxgh0st’s method of operation largely hinges on exploiting well-known vulnerabilities that allow unauthorized access and remote code execution. Among these, PHP’s CVE-2017-9841, Laravel’s CVE-2018-15133, and Apache’s CVE-2021-41773 have been particularly targeted. Such vulnerabilities are critical because they enable attackers to execute malicious code remotely, potentially gaining control over affected systems. The US Cybersecurity and Infrastructure Security Agency (CISA) has been proactive in issuing advisories to alert organizations about Androxgh0st’s activities, stressing the importance of addressing these security gaps immediately. Nevertheless, despite these efforts, the botnet continues to show resilience, capitalizing on any unpatched deficiencies it encounters.

The introduction of Mozi’s IoT-focused payloads into Androxgh0st’s arsenal signals a significant shift in its operational strategy. Historically, Mozi had targeted routers, DVRs, and other IoT devices before its disruption in 2021. The resurrection of these payloads under the Androxgh0st banner has amplified concerns within the cybersecurity community. This combination means that not only are traditional web servers at risk, but everyday IoT devices, which often lack robust security measures, are now equally vulnerable. The implications of this are far-reaching, considering the extensive use of IoT devices in both residential and commercial settings.

Mitigation Strategies and Best Practices

Organizations need to implement robust security protocols to protect against Androxgh0st’s expanding threat vector. Regularly updating systems and applying patches to known vulnerabilities are essential steps in defense. Additionally, enhancing monitoring capabilities to detect unusual activities early can help mitigate potential damage. It’s also crucial to educate personnel on the importance of cybersecurity hygiene to prevent inadvertent compromises. Engaging with cybersecurity experts and staying informed about emerging threats will be vital in maintaining a secure enterprise and IoT environment.
